EDU 210 - Cultural Diversity in Education

EDU 210. Cultural Diversity in Education (3). Prepares potential teachers to examine how race, ethnicity, and cultural differences influence students' experiences in school. Assists teachers in implementing a multicultural approach to teaching by identifying effective teaching styles and practices for a diverse student population. Three lecture.
